The incoming governor of Anambra State, Prof Chukwuma Soludo, has vowed to terminate all revenue collection contracts in the state as soon as he is sworn-in into office on March 17, 2022.
The governor-elect spoke during an interaction with critical stakeholders in the state at Agulu, Anaocha Local Government Area on Saturday. He accused those at the helm of affairs at the state revenue board of giving revenue contracts to their friends and cronies.
